The cost of a move with Wheaton World Wide Moving is influenced by several factors, which vary depending on the specific details of each move. One of the primary considerations is the distance between the origin and destination. For long-distance moves, the cost typically increases with the miles traveled, while local moves might have a different pricing structure based on time and labor.
Another important factor is the weight of the items being transported. Wheaton Movers generally calculates moving costs based on the total weight of the shipment, as heavier loads require more resources. To obtain an accurate estimate, it is advisable to provide a detailed list of items that will be included in the move, as this aids in assessing the weight and space needed.
The services selected during the move also play a significant role in determining the overall cost. For example, if additional services such as packing, unpacking, or storage are required, these can add to the expense. Custom services, such as specialty handling for fragile or oversized items, may also incur additional fees.
Timing can also impact pricing. Moving during peak times, such as weekends or summer months, may lead to higher rates compared to off-peak periods.
Wheaton World Wide Moving often offers free estimates, allowing customers to evaluate their moving costs based on the aforementioned factors before finalizing their decision. For the most accurate and personalized quote, individuals should consider gathering specific details about their move and checking the current Wheaton web page for more information about their estimating process. By understanding these components, customers can make informed choices and better prepare for their upcoming relocation.
